Vilon

Vilon (Lys-Glu) is the smallest known immunomodulatory peptide, consisting of just two amino acids. Developed by Professor Khavinson, Vilon has been shown to stimulate thymic function, promote T-cell differentiation, and enhance immune system competence — particularly in aging organisms where thymic involution has reduced immune capacity. Research demonstrates that Vilon can partially reverse age-related immune decline and shows geroprotective (anti-aging) properties in animal models. Despite its simplicity, Vilon represents a significant advancement in peptide bioregulation research, demonstrating that even dipeptides can carry meaningful biological signals.
